Madison Hall

Madison Hall is scheduled to have a Louisiana State Capital Outlay Funded Project managed by LA Facility Planning and Control that will renovate all HVAC, Mechanical, Electrical and Plumbing and finishes and spaces. This is a Three Phase $16 Million Renovation over the next few years Spring/Summer 2024 through July 2026. The anticipated and hopeful Full Building Completion and Reopening date will be before the Fall 2026 Semester if the project goes according to plan with no major surprises or setbacks. The plan is to finish each phase in the scheduled time and allow for a 1-to-2-month construction pause window between each phase to move into completed areas and out of the next phase’s work area.

Details of the work include upgrading and improving ADA Accessibility throughout the facility, new and renovated doors, raising some ceilings, and restructuring walls and spaces to accommodate today’s Engineering Department needs. This project includes new HVAC systems, electrical upgrades, restroom renovations and other finishes and surfaces will be improved.

This is a 1957 constructed building that has not had a major upgrade or overall building wide interior renovation since it was built.
